Holidays in Benidorm

Benidorm: Enjoy a Spanish Holiday

Summary:  

 

The exotic locations, a wide variety of theme parks, restaurants, bars and the friendly nature of the people is what makes Benidorm a special place to visit.

 

Full Article:

Benidorm is in the north east of Alicante at a distance of about 45 km. It is known for its big buildings, beautiful beaches and lively nightlife. Benidorm is protected from the cold winds coming from the north, by the high mountains that surrounding it, which is why the weather condition remains cool throughout the year. Poniente and Levante are the two halves in which the city of Benidorm is divided. The percentage of tourists coming to Benidorm is the highest as compared to any other town in Spain.

 

Sightseeing-

 

The church of San Jaime is the most visited by the tourists from across the world. Visiting Benidorm Aquarium at Calle Horno can be full of excitement if you are interested in underwater activities. You can visit a variety of theme parks namely Terra Mitica Park, Mundomar Aquatic Park, and Aqualandia Park. Terra Miticas Park has a theme that is based on the ancient history and has Mediterranean civilization of Egypt, Greece, Iberia, and Rome. 

 

At night, Benidorm comes alive with a large variety of nightclubs and discos around. You will also find different cafes, restaurants, and bars to choose from. You will find a mixture of different cultures coming from different parts of the world. You can find the bars from English to German and from Cuban to the very own Spanish, all parts of the world get united at Benidorm. There are a total of 800 bars and cafés along with pubs and discos namely Pacha, KM, and KU. Enjoy some of the best cuisines at more than three hundred restaurants in the city and enjoy.  

 

Staying at Benidorm-

 

Benidorm has to offers some of the best hotels and apartments. You will find a variety of five star hotels and to spa resorts here. You can also visit some of the famous campsites. Majority of the chains of the hotels are managed by Spanish people.

Make sure that you avoid coming to Benidorm during the summer time as you will face some problems finding a hotel room for yourself. As for the off-season, you can find a number of hotel rooms and that too at a competitive price.  

 

Traveling Benidorm-

 

If you want to travel around Benidorm, Costa Blanca and Altea, then the best option suggested is traveling by car. You can avail services from more than fifteen car rental companies extending their services in Benidorm. When you arrive at Benidorm you can also take a bus or probably hire a car from the airport to Benidorm. The weather conditions remain just perfect even in the winters.     

 

Language-

 

The two of the main languages spoken in Benidorm are Spanish and Velenciano. The other language popular spoken in Benidorm is English, the reason for which is that a major part of the population comprises of English and Irish people.

Amsterdam Holidays

 

With large tourist attractions as well as amazing festivities and cultural activities, Amsterdam proves to be great holiday destination.

Established in 12th century as a fishing village, today Amsterdam is the largest and most popular city of Netherlands. Although Amsterdam is fairly small, the city is packed with hundreds of treasures for travelers.

 

Here are a few of Amsterdam’s most popular attractions and sightseeing activities listed to make your travel experience the best possible.

 

Museums

 

When touring Amsterdam, it is worth visiting its variety of museums famous for their historical and antique collections. Some of the major museums of Amsterdam are Rijksmuseum (know for its 17th century Dutch collected works), Steldelejk museum, Kroller-Muller (named on the daughter of a rich and eminent German industrialist) and Van Gogh museum (known for its collection of paintings by Van Gogh and other eminent artists from 19th century). With more than 50 museums each boosting amazing collections, it would be a sad thing to miss the experience of museum tour when holidaying in Amsterdam.

 

The Dam square

 

The Dam square is known for its historical value and is often an important part of many Amsterdam tours. The beauty and the historical background of this Dam make it a part of every tourist’s visit, when touring Amsterdam. The various fascinating things about the Dam are also documented in the historical museum of Amsterdam. Dam square is located 5 minutes walking distance from Amsterdam Central Station and 2 minutes walking distance from the Red Light District.

 

Amsterdam Canal Cruise

 

A holiday in Amsterdam can never be complete without going on the Amsterdam Canal Cruise, through its magnificent and incredible canals. Cruising along the canals is the best way to cherish and see Amsterdam, as you get to see marvelous 17th century houses and mansions, as well as startling architecture.

 

Oude Kerk

 

Surrounded with small houses, Oude Kerk is a very old and beautiful church, adored by many visitors both locals and foreigners. The church’s building is designed in a Gothic-renaissance style and has an octagonal bell tower. Located at the centre of red light district, the church has become quite popular among visitors to Amsterdam.

 

Hortus Botanicus – (the Botanical Garden)

 

With well over 6000 plants, Hortus Botanicus is quite an old and unique botanical garden. Dating back to 1632, it has some plants almost 2000 years old. It is situated within easy walking distance of other major tourist attractions like the Amsterdam zoo and resistance as well as historical museum; the garden is a remarkable place to enjoy your holiday in Amsterdam.

 

Albert Cuyp market

 

With more than 300 stalls, Albert Cuyp market is one of the most busiest and popular tourist attractions. This remarkable outdoor market has a variety of products and is situated in Pijp district. Surrounded with numerous shops and cafes, the market gets to see huge amount of visitors, local and foreigners, everyday.

 

The Best time to visit or holiday in Amsterdam

 

With its tourist attractions and friendly local people, touring Amsterdam at anytime of the year proves to be worthwhile. But the best time of year or the peak season for holidaying in Amsterdam is in the pleasant months of July and August. Even in the off-season Amsterdam tours are still quite popular.

Paris Holidays

With Disney Paris, Louvre museum, exotic fragrances and hot couture, the city of Paris has a lot more to offer to its visitors than they would ever expect.

 

Set up near the end of the 3rd century BC by the Celtic Gauls tribe, Paris was initially named as the Parisii. The Paris city is established on what is now known as the Ile de la Cite. 

It would not be wrong to say that life never sleeps in Paris. This capital city of France is incomparable for its large number of attractions, offering something for everyone to enjoy.  

 

The feel of the Paris city is such that it leaves each and every tourist bizarre and spell bound with its beauty. With its riches in creative, unusual and prized assets, this city of lovers demands enough time in hand to do justice to its beauty and discover the entire city completely.

 

Attractions in Paris:

 

Eiffel Tower

 

One of the world’s most recognizable monuments, Eiffel Tower is an awe-inspiring beauty with a spectacular view of the city through its lift.

 

Louvre Museum

 

The Louvre is also known as one of the worlds most popular piece is Leonardo da Vinci’s “Mona Lisa.” It was established in 1793, and is one of the oldest museums in Europe. Its collections spans from the birth of great civilizations up to the 19th century. A whopping 5.7 million tourists visited the museum in 2002.

 

Disney Paris

 

Disney Paris is definitely one of the places every Paris visitor must visit. Although the Florida Disney is beautiful too, the Paris Disney has a unique spectacular charm to it, making it a much more thrilling experience for all.

To visit Disneyland Park completely, an entire day at hand would be a good idea. Another day in hand could be a great to visit Walt Disney Studio Park. Lots of restaurants and great entertainments like golfing at Golf Disneyland are also up for grabs here.

 

Parc Asterix

 

Another amazing theme park, Parc Asterix should be included in your holiday in Paris. Parc Asterix has a lot to offer to its tourists especially for those on a fun family vacation. While in Parc Asterix, people can have fun watching the dolphins play at the Dolphin show or can get a little adventurous and explore the park.

 

Cathedrale Notre Dame

 

Cathedrale Notre Dame lies in the heart of Paris. Also known worldwide as a masterpiece of the French Gothic Architecture, Notre Dame de Paris or Cathedrale Notre Dame has been a ceremonial focus for the Catholic Paris’ since seven centuries now. With huge interiors, marvelous engineering and spectacular rose windows, this cathedrale is famous for a capacity of holding more than 6000 people.

 

Shopping in Paris

 

Parisian shops offer some of the finest attractions of the city to its tourists. From selling local products like pottery; clothes; wine and antiques, to some distinctively established couture brands and fragrances, you name and you’ll get it in “de Paris”.

One of the most attractive shopping districts in Paris is the Les Halles, which includes a submarine shopping complex, “Forum des Halles”. When in Paris, no one can afford to miss out on a little luxury shopping for oneself.

 

From art to architecture and from magnificent Eiffel tower to Seine River, the city of lights, romance and art is just like a better version of bliss.
